The M. Sc Degree Examination previous year question paper of KSOU or Karnataka State Open University is as follows: 1. a) Prove that the sum of PE and KE remains constant for a system of particles moving under the action of a conservative force. b) Define centre of mass for a system of particles (10+5) (OR) 2. a) Starting from D’Alembert’s principle, derive an expression for Lagrange’s equations of motion. b) What are constraints? Write their classification. (10+5) 3. a) Derive Hamilton’s canonical equations of motion from variational principle. b) Obtain Hamiltonian for one dimensional simple harmonic oscillator. (10+5) (OR) 4. a) Define the term ‘canonical transformation’ and hence derive the condition for a canonical transformation. b) Define Poisson bracket and express Hamilton’s equation of motion using Poisson’s equation. (10+5) 5. a) Using Hamilton –Jacobi method solve one dimensional harmonic oscillator problem. b) State and prove parallel axis theorem. (10+5) (OR) 6. a) Set up Euler equations of motion for a rigid body. b) What do you mean by inertia? Explain its physical significance. |
